Description

New in paperback, this is a fully illustrated volume on the discovery, meaning and significance of all the Dead Sea Scrolls by acknowledged experts in the field. Offering intriguing historical and religious insights into the period of authorship, from Babylon to Bar Kokhba, and expert interpretation of the manuscripts using palaeography, Carbon-14 dating and computer reconstructions, the book also Includes factfiles, tables, reconstructions, scroll photographs and a guide to where to see the scrolls today.

About the Author

Philip R. Davies is Research Professor at the University of Sheffield, England. He is author of over a dozen books in Old Testament and Dead Sea Scroll studies, including Scribes and Schools in the Library of Ancient Israel series.
